The ongoing Covid-19 pandemic and the devastating effect it is having on the world is unprecedented in our lifetimes. While human health and safety must of course be put before everything, the impact the virus has already had on the FEI Calendar is a huge concern and we are all too aware of the consequences on you as Organisers.

These are difficult and uncertain times for us all and, for those of you that have already been forced to cancel your Events and those of you who may need to cancel in the near future, the financial and personal implications are huge. We want to assure all of you that we are looking at all the ways in which we can help and, as a starting point, have already agreed that Calendar fees for Events that have had to be cancelled because of Covid-19 will be waived. Clearly where an Event is cancelled, no organising dues or MCP contributions will be applicable.

But obviously that’s only part of the story. Even after the pandemic is over and we have done everything in our power to agree new dates for those of you that request them, we are also conscious of the fact that the postponement of the Tokyo 2020 Olympic and Paralympic Games and the necessity to find new dates in 2021 adds to the level of concern.

Clearly there will be FEI Events affected by the rescheduling of the Games, but we have been assured by the IOC that they will work together with all the International Federations to find the best solutions, and that will include looking at the international fixture list to try and minimise the impact.

As you are probably aware, the FEI yesterday announced the creation of a series of discipline-specific task forces whose remit will be to evaluate the overall impact on the FEI Calendar, both of the Covid-19 pandemic and the postponement of Tokyo 2020.

As Secretary General, I have overall responsibility for the FEI Calendar, so I will be chairing each of the task forces as we seek ways to help our Organisers, National Federations, Athletes, Officials and everyone else caught up in this desperately difficult situation.

It will not be an easy task, but please understand that the President of the International Equestrian Organisers Association Peter Bollen will be a member of each of the eight single-discipline task forces, so your interests will be well represented.
